Murex In Webster's Dictionary

\Mu"rex\, n.; pl. {Murices}. [L., the purple fish.] (Zo["o]l.) A genus of marine gastropods, having rough, and frequently spinose, shells, which are often highly colored inside; the rock shells. They abound in tropical seas.
